Log Home Repair in Charleston, SC
Log home repair services focus on maintaining and restoring the structural integrity and appearance of log cabins and homes. These services typically cover projects such as replacing or repairing damaged logs, addressing settling or shifting issues, sealing gaps to improve energy efficiency, and restoring weathered or rotted wood. Property owners often seek assistance with issues like cracked or split logs, insect damage, and moisture-related problems to ensure their home remains safe, durable, and visually appealing.

Common Log Home Repair Jobs
Log home siding repair - restoring the exterior surface to protect against weather and improve appearance.
Foundation stabilization - addressing settling or shifting issues to maintain structural integrity.
Roof repairs - fixing leaks, damaged shingles, or framing to ensure proper protection from the elements.
Window and door restoration - replacing or repairing openings to improve energy efficiency and security.
Interior log replacement - removing and replacing damaged or decayed logs to preserve the home’s stability.
Chinking and sealing services - applying or renewing sealant to prevent drafts and moisture intrusion.
Log Home Repair Questions
What types of log home repairs are commonly needed? Common repairs include fixing rot, replacing damaged logs, sealing gaps, and addressing insect damage to maintain structural integrity.
How can I tell if my log home needs repairs? Signs include visible cracks, sagging, mold or mildew, and increased drafts around windows and doors.
Are there preventative measures to avoid major repairs? Regular inspections, sealing gaps, and addressing minor issues early can help prevent costly repairs later.
What projects are typical for log home repair services? Projects often involve log replacement, chinking and sealing, foundation stabilization, and moisture management.
